logo

Output 8905fe699a1318dd71385b7b343141dfcf5be5a93c86eb07519ac06b13ea4cb1:1

value
5245408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 619bc128283327f68ec11a20f5993e3d23d9fc3a OP_EQUAL
address
3Ab84AXLXTkyw7WGXA2bAd9vxvVwmDuecU
transaction
8905fe699a1318dd71385b7b343141dfcf5be5a93c86eb07519ac06b13ea4cb1